Breaking: Cowboys Could Lose Free Agent Despite Bargain Spending

March 13, 2025 by Last Word On Pro Football

free agent donovan wilson

The Dallas Cowboys could lose free agent safety Donovan Wilson this offseason despite the team bargain shopping in free agency. According to a few sources, there’s reason to believe the Cowboys aren’t bringing back Wilson after giving Markquese Bell a new contract. Originally selected in the sixth round of the 2019 NFL Draft, the former Texas A&M product made $24 million across his six years with the Cowboys but he’s coming off a down season. Wilson hasn’t been the same since stepping into the safety position as the starter alongside Malik Hooker so this could be the offseason that will likely see the veteran head elsewhere.

Bell is signing a three-year, $9 million dollar deal which is surprising given that he’s been more of a backup for the secondary unit. It seems like the Cowboys are going to emerge him as the starter but he’s been establishing himself as an important piece for the team even though Bell is more of a special-teams player. Wilson will count more than $8 million against the cap and that number is significant when he hasn’t been producing as much as the defense was expecting. After the hiring of Matt Eberflus for defensive coordinator, it shouldn’t be surprising if the Cowboys decide to part ways with Wilson and these five teams could take a chance as a backup depth.

Possible Next Teams

New Orleans Saints

The New Orleans Saints are on a bargain hunt as well despite finding a way to sign safety Justin Reid. He now pairs with Tyrann Mathieu who restructured his deal to make the signing happen but they could use some solid depth. Donovan Wilson won’t start but he could register a few tackles to keep the safety intact.

Kansas City Chiefs

For the Chiefs, the team needs any type of safety after losing Reid to pair with Bryan Cook. Last offseason was a brutal one for the secondary unit after trading away L’Jarius Sneed but the Chiefs don’t have big-time money to spend. Perhaps, they could bring in Wilson on a one-year and see how he performs as a backup.

Baltimore Ravens

Kyle Hamilton and Ar’Darius Washington will likely become the new starters for the Ravens’ safety unit. Free Agent Marcus Williams lost his job to Washington last season but the Ravens could use the depth themselves too. Baltimore may cut or restructure Marlon Humphrey’s contract so that should give them room to sign a guy like Wilson.

Washington Commanders

The same case can be said about the Washington Commanders. Safety Quan Martin is a durable athlete who has plenty of years ahead of him and with signing Will Harris, they could use some depth in Donovan Wilson. Head Coach Dan Quinn is no stranger to getting former Cowboys on the team. Quinn could sign Wilson as a reliable depth piece if Noah Igbinoghene doesn’t return.

Los Angeles Chargers

The Chargers have been playing it smartly by ear signing a few free agents on a bargain this offseason. However, they need a replacement for Derwin James Jr. if they don’t plan to bring him back. Alohi Gilman needs a solid opposite of him and even though Wilson won’t start, he could have some bright spots.
